The Rhea 900 is an elegant and high-performance boat designed by Rhea Marine, a renowned builder of high-quality vessels. This model is ideal for sailing enthusiasts seeking a perfect balance between comfort, performance, and versatility.
Dimensions: The Rhea 900 measures 9 meters in overall length, with a beam of 3 meters, offering generous onboard space. The draft is 0.85 meters, allowing for easy navigation even in shallow waters.
Engine: This boat is generally equipped with a 300-horsepower inboard diesel engine, providing sufficient power for optimal performance. The transmission is ensured by a fixed-pitch propeller, guaranteeing efficient and reliable propulsion.
Capacity: The Rhea 900 can accommodate up to 8 people onboard, making it an excellent choice for family outings or gatherings with friends. The fuel capacity is 300 liters, allowing for extended outings without frequent refueling.
